Whenever you can, be open with your team about potential problems. It used to be that hiding business problems was the norm, but now great leaders do the opposite. What’s the reason? It’s because people can easily communicate nowadays. There will be someone talking about the problem whether you wish for them to or not. Controlling the information yourself is much better than scrambling in response. This is the path of true leadership.

Integrity is essential to a good leader. The two best ways to pragmatically practice integrity are to always speak the truth and do what is right, especially when you think no one’s watching you. If your integrity is lacking, the trust of others will surely prove elusive. Leadership with integrity earns your respect and trust.

Work on your writing skills. Being a leader involves more than your vision and the way you hold yourself. Your success relies on your use of words, as well. If you write sloppily, with poor grammar and misspellings, then it’ll be hard for your employees or partners to take you seriously as a leader. Take note of these things and pay some attention to what you’re writing.
